TUNA IN THE STRAW CASSEROLE

Shoestring potatoes give this main dish great flavor and crunch. Even my husband, who doesn't normally care for tuna, counts it among his favorites.-Kallee McCreery, Escondido, California

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 can (10-3/4 ounces) condensed cream of mushroom soup, undiluted
1 can (5 ounces) evaporated milk
1 can (5 ounces) albacore white tuna in water
1 can (4 ounces) mushroom stems and pieces, drained
1 cup frozen mixed vegetables
2 cups potato sticks, divided

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, stir soup and milk until blended. Stir in the tuna, mushrooms, vegetables and 1-1/2 cups potato sticks. , Transfer to a greased 1-1/2-qt. baking dish. Bake, uncovered, at 375° for 20 minutes. Sprinkle with the remaining potatoes. Bake 5-10 minutes longer or until bubbly and potatoes are crisp.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 289 calories, Fat 13g fat (5g saturated fat), Cholesterol 28mg cholesterol, Sodium 881mg sodium, Carbohydrate 26g carbohydrate (6g sugars, Fiber 4g fiber), Protein 18g protein.
